The Level 3 Diploma in Water Network – Distribution is a combined qualification covering the underpinning knowledge and practical skills required by a water network distribution technicians.
This qualification covers the underpinning knowledge and practical skills in the following units:
- Water Treatment and Networks – Regulation and Compliance
- Water Treatment and Networks – Science and Applied Mathematics
- Water Network – Customer Service
- Water Network – Materials and Components
- Water Network – Operation of Service Reservoirs, Pumps and Trunk Mains
- Water Network – Operation of District Metered Areas
- Water Network Distribution – Supply Interruptions
- Water Network Distribution – Water Quality and Hygiene
There are no entry requirements for this qualification. There is a requirement for learners to provide evidence generated in the workplace and must therefore have access to the working environment and tasks that allow them to complete the qualification.
Delivery is a mixture of classroom sessions and on site assessment.
